Prairie dogs are rodents that live in colonies. Black-tailed prairie dog (Cynomys ludovicianus) colonies typically have around 1
Tresset [83]

Population density is the aspect of population ecology of the black-tailed prairie dog does this statement describe.

Explanation:

Population density is the number of organisms are there in per unit area. It is used to measure geographical area occupied by organisms and its statistics.

In population ecology the structure, dynamics and contribution of population of species is studied. The idea of species distribution is studied in it.

The population density determines the number of species or members of particular population are present is a particular area.

An area of  low density population will have more resources and more area per organism and less competition for resources and vice versa for high density population.

Prairie dogs have 12 adults per hectare of area this tells the population density of the rodents.

How can carbohydrates, lipids, and proteins be detected in foods?
tino4ka555 [31]
The Benedict’s Test is the test which can detect carbohydrates and glucose in foods. During this process, the sample or the food is placed into a test tube and then some drops of Benedict's solution is added to it,and is then put into a beaker of boiling water. When the mixture of food and the Benedict substance turns reddish orange instead of staying blue, this means that it is positive. The mixture has simple sugar or has carbohydrates or glucose. On the other hand, lipids are tested using the brown paper test. When the paper turns transparent when a drop of food is put into it, it means that is is positive as well. When you want to test if the food has proteins, you have to test it with Biurets. Observe if the color change when you put some Biurets solution to the food sample. It is positive if the food turns light purple. Test if the food is positive with starches through the use of iodine. Food having iodine drops should turn purple instead of staying a yellow color.
